What problem does it solve?

This Skill streamlines the creation and configuration of AI agents within Kibana's Agent Builder, allowing users to quickly set up intelligent agents for data analysis and management.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Agent Creation: Define and instantiate new AI agents with custom names, descriptions, and system instructions.
  • Tool Integration: Automatically wire agents to relevant platform and data source tools for enhanced functionality.
  • Use Case: You need to create a new AI agent in Kibana to monitor security logs. Use this Skill to name the agent 'Security Sentinel', provide a description, and connect it to the 'log-analysis' and 'alerting' tools.
